Guerilla cooking: freeing yourself from your kitchen

Brian Palmer over at Slate has an interesting discussion, “You Don’t Need a Kitchen to be a Chef: the Fine Art of Guerilla Cooking.” As he points out, “just as you can sleep wherever you happen to be tired, you can cook anywhere so long as you have the essentials (food, heat).” His advice about preparing food in the office is particularly useful – get a camping stove or electric fondue pot, and you’re ready to go. What’s not to like about eating not only healthier but better?
